The Sixth Section of the Provincial Court of Las Palmas will host the trial next week against M.R.M., who has no prior criminal record, for whom the Public Prosecutor's Office is seeking a sentence of eight years in prison for an alleged sexual assault with penetration that occurred in Playa Blanca.
The facts, according to the Public Prosecutor's written statement, occurred between 8:00 PM and 8:30 PM on September 29, 2022, at the pool bar of the Hotel Relaxia Club Lanza Sur. The accused, who was working at the location, allegedly approached a tourist staying at the establishment as she **was heading to the restrooms**.
The document states that M.R.M., "with the intention of satisfying his sexual desires and against the tourist's will," grabbed her forcefully, took her into one of the bathrooms, and closed the door. As a consequence of the assault, **the victim suffered injuries** in the right subscapular region, on the posterior side of the right arm, on the left breast, and on both buttocks, as recognized by the forensic doctor. These injuries required initial medical attention and took 10 days to heal, three of which prevented them from carrying out their usual activities.
The Public Prosecutor's Office classifies the events as a sexual assault with penetration and requests, in addition to eight years in prison, special disqualification from the right to passive suffrage for the duration of the sentence, prohibition of approaching or communicating with the victim and of returning to the scene of the events or going to her home for a period of ten years, a measure of supervised release for six years and special disqualification from any profession, trade or activity that involves regular and direct contact with minors for fifteen years.
In terms of civil liability, the Prosecutor's Office claims that the defendant compensate the victim with 425 euros for injuries and 1,500 euros for moral damages suffered, amounts that will accrue legal interest increased by two points
